Burt Reynolds died of a heart attack Thursday morning at a hospital in Florida, according to multiple reports.
Reynold was 82.
Burt was transported a Florida hospital after going into cardiac arrest. His family was by his side when he passed.
Burt was a star in the moves and on TV -- appearing in classics like "Smokey and the Bandit," "Boogie Knights" and "Cannonball Run."
